This week's is a set of reconfigurable candlestick holders I made for Christmas a few weeks ago. They are made of Walnut grown locally in Mystic, Ct, and maple from who knows where. The cool part about these is that each one is made from a single glued up block so when the "leaves" are folded flat, the grain pattern is continuous. They can also be fanned out in any shape you could want, in a circle, a random stepping pattern, or a wave, lots of options. The basic idea for this came from a cool book bought for me but I, of course, took it up a few notches and even added custom hardware; I can't do anything the easy way!

Time for a little bit of with an endgrain cutting board I made for a great family friend up in New Hampshire for Christmas 2020. This board is made from black walnut grown in and is 13 inches wide, 20 inches long, and weighs about 13 lbs!
